Customer-Concentration Risk — Finance Review Summary

For the board: Vantrell Logistics now accounts for 41% of annual revenue, up from 29% two years ago. Margin on the account has compressed to 14%. Contract renewal falls in Q1. Diversification efforts in the Ostbridge segment remain behind plan. Mitigation options depend on the following direction:

board note of bajop-yaweg: The western region missed its Pelys quota by 58.0 percent last quarter. Pelysek Foods plans to raise the Belius list price by 44.0 percent in July. The steering committee signed off on a budget of $133.8 million for Project Pelax. The renewal with Zoraelix Systems closes at $61.9 million a year, 12.7 percent above the last contract.

# Artifact Signing — Liftwright Simulator

For this week's sync: the Liftwright elevator-dispatch simulator now signs every artifact at build time, including the scenario packs. Unsigned scenario packs are rejected by the loader as of v4.2, so rebuild any local packs before demoing. Verification during review should be done against the current release key below.

signing key of bagap-yawep = bky13_TbfT6ZMUoGJo2

## Formula sandbox tuning

User-supplied formulas in Gridmoor execute inside a restricted interpreter with hard ceilings on time, memory, and call depth. Reviewers should confirm any change to these ceilings is justified in the PR description, since raising them widens the abuse surface. Defaults were chosen from production traces. The current limits are as follows.

limits module of tafog-fawip:
WEIGHTS = {
    "julix": 57,
    "lamys": 992,
    "kasvan": 209,
    "quenok": 750,
    "alddor": 259,
    "oliath": 1009,
    "wenix": 815,
}

Ticket: Staging env misconfigured for Siftgate bloom filter

The bloom layer in front of the Pellet KV store is rejecting all lookups in staging because the env file was copied from the dev template without credentials. False-positive tuning values are fine; only the auth line is missing. To unblock the weekly demo, the Pellet admission secret must be set on the following line.

env line for yaguf-fajop: LEDGER_TOKEN13=fb08984397349